Subject: DR drill notes — Palisade health checks

Team, Saturday's drill will fail the primary health-check endpoint behind the Corvane load balancer and confirm failover drains cleanly. Future maintainers: keep this note with the drill archive. Restoring the standby config store prompts for the recovery passphrase, which is recorded on the following line.

unlock words, tagaf-yageg: holwyn-ulaael

Handover: Quillbase formula sandbox. User-supplied expressions now run in the Tinderbox interpreter with a 50ms budget, no I/O, and a frozen stdlib whitelist. Plugin authors must declare required functions in the manifest; undeclared calls fail closed. The recursion-depth limit is enforced pre-execution. Questions about whitelist extensions should be routed to the sandbox owner named below.

named custodian: Brivan Eliath Quenox Frador

## Support

Castcheck validates RSS and podcast namespace tags for feeds published through the Murmuration platform. If a feed fails validation and the error message isn't clear, check the rules reference in `docs/rules.md` first — most questions are answered there. Bugs go in the tracker with a sample feed attached. For access issues or anything contract-related, contact the maintainers at the address below.

escalation mailbox, bafog-fafog: ulador@paliqlabs.internal